Exploring the World of Scottish Tartans
Scottish tartans are renowned for their vibrant colours and intricate patterns, each with a rich history and symbolism. These distinctive woven fabrics have been worn by Scots for centuries, serving as a visual representation of clan affiliation, personal identity, or special occasions. Featuring the classic red and blue hues of the Highland Warrior tartan to the more subtle shades of the MacTavish tartan, the variety of designs is truly staggering. Each tartan tells a unique story, passed down through generations, and understanding their meanings can provide a fascinating glimpse into Scottish culture.
- Famous tartan patterns often symbolize significant events in history or the natural landscapes of Scotland. For instance, the Black Watch tartan, with its striking black and green colours, commemorates a legendary military unit.
- Various tartans are associated with specific clans, such as the bold red and white pattern of the MacDonald clan or the deep blue hues of the Fraser clan. Wearing these tartans can serve as a powerful symbol of heritage and family ties.
- Although many tartans have traditional meanings, some modern designs are created for unique expression or to celebrate contemporary events.

Unveiling the Elegance of a Traditional Scottish Kilt Outfit
A traditional Scottish kilt outfit embodies a captivating blend of history, culture, and sartorial grace. The kilt itself, a pleated piece woven from tartan fabric, reflects the wearer's clan heritage and regional affiliation. Adorned with a sporran, a leather pouch worn at the waist, and paired with traditional accessories such as a sgian-dubh (a small knife) and ghillie brogues (shoes), the outfit exudes an air of rugged charm.
The kilt's classic elegance complemented by a carefully picked jacket and waistcoat. Choosing for a matching tartan enhances the overall cohesiveness of the ensemble, while contrasting colors bring a touch of personality. Whether the occasion, a traditional Scottish kilt outfit kilt for men is a timeless choice that demonstrates respect for heritage and an appreciation for exquisite taste.
